The govrnment has held the opposition responsible for the scuffle that broke out in the Rajya Sabha on Wednesday,denied allegations and accused the Opposition of staging 'drama' and insulting democracy. in a joint conference in New Delhi, eight union ministers lashes out the opposition for "disruptive and threatening behaviour" that forced Parliament to close two days early. Countering allegations that "outsiders who were not part of Parliament security were brought in to manhandle opposition leaders and members, including women MPs", union minister Piyush Goyal said that there were 12 lady marshals and 18 men. They were not outsiders. Their figures are wrong. Allegations of the Opposition are wrong. The way the lady marshal was manhandled by two MPs from Congress... the way they tried to pull the male marshal by his neck... it was a shameful disgrace," he said.
Union Minister Anurag Thakur has said the Opposition should seek forgiveness from the country and not shred crocodile tears. The people of this nation gave the government a duty... to find solutions for their concerns. But we all have seen how the opposition has been totally disruptive in not letting Parliament function, he said.
Parliamentary Affairs Pralhad Joshi held the Opposition responsible for the deadlock in Parliament. He said, "It is most unfortunate that from the first day of all-party meeting indications were there that we won’t allow the House to run. It was made amply clear by TMC and Congress this session is meant for washout. "We had to take a decision to end the monsoon session early because, and I am quoting the opposition was literally threatening that if we attempt to pass other bills (after the OBC and Insurance bills) there will be even more serious damage in Parliament," he said.
"If Rahul Gandhi says no discussion was allowed... how there was a discussion on Covid... on the OBC bill.... when it suits them they will allow the House to function, else hold it hostage," Goyal said. The Opposition has put a question mark over what is the picture of Parliamentary democracy we want to show our youth and countrymen. They couldn’t decide one issue they wanted to discuss. One party wanted one thing, another party wanted another thing," Piyush Goyal said.
